About AUO
AUO Corporation is a Taiwan-based technology company that develops and manufactures display products and related solutions. Its portfolio includes thin-film transistor liquid-crystal displays (TFT-LCD), active-matrix organic light-emitting diode (AMOLED) panels, and emerging technologies such as mini LED and micro LED displays.
The company supplies display components and integrated solutions for a variety of applications, including televisions, monitors, notebook computers, tablets, smartphones, automotive systems, industrial equipment, medical devices, and other commercial products.
